Ehalkivi is an erratic boulder in Letipea, Lääne-Viru County, Estonia; for its volume is the largest of its kind in Estonia, and one of the largest of its kind in the glaciation area of North Europe.
Dimensions
• Height: 7.6 m • Circumference: 49.6 (measured at 1.5 m from water surface) • Volume: 930 m3 • Mass: ca 2,500 t ==References==
